Besides a failed try at renaming the university in the 90's they are currently in a process to find a much needed new name since they now have men's sports. Let's just say it's not going well.
In early January a new name of Mississippi Brightwell University was announced. This was pretty much universally rejected by all alumni, people threatening to stop donating, etc. The renaming was quickly paused in order to redo the process.
In the last couple of weeks another name was announced. Wynbridge State University of Mississippi. Since MUW is a public university the name change has to go through the legislature. Apparently this latest name doesn't have the support to pass so the renaming has again been paused.
They have sent surveys to alumni over the last year or so but apparently they didn't or weren't able to find anything useful info from those.
